The Future of Engineering at Coimbra

TSC is proud to introduce the successful installation of a state-of-the-art Virtual Reality Control Room (VCR) at the University of Coimbra’s Chemical Engineering building. This advanced facility is designed to enhance students’ understanding of real-world operations and control systems, providing hands-on experience with multiple engineering disciplines. 

While housed in the Chemical Engineering building, this VCR is intended for use across multiple engineering disciplines, ensuring a broad impact on the university’s educational offerings.

Key Features

Voice Over IP (VOIP) Phone System: Facilitates seamless communication within the control room and with external contacts.

Radios: Enables effective communication for field operations and emergency situations.

Wall-Based Alarm Panels: Displayed on small monitors, these panels allow for real-time monitoring and alterations.

Speaker System: Plays realistic plant sound effects to simulate an operational environment.

Networked PCs: The room includes 2 trainer and 4 trainee PCs networked on a Local LAN, all installed with a range of dynamic process training simulations.

Custom Desks: Designed to mimic the layout and feel of an actual control room, enhancing the training experience.

Virtual 3D Environment: Located in a separate room, this setup allows a field operator to connect to the control room via a dedicated PC, offering a comprehensive training experience that includes virtual reality field operations
